首页 话题 小组 问答 好文 用户 我的社区 域名交易

[分享]css中hr为什么不显示出来

发布于 2024-11-11 19:31:28
0
28

在CSS中,是用于添加水平分割线的标签。但有时候我们会发现在页面上,这些分割线并没有被正确地显示出来。最常见的原因是因为页面中的CSS代码覆盖了默认的样式,导致其无法被正确地渲染出来。 hr { di...

在CSS中,<hr>是用于添加水平分割线的标签。但有时候我们会发现在页面上,这些分割线并没有被正确地显示出来。

最常见的原因是因为页面中的CSS代码覆盖了默认的<hr>样式,导致其无法被正确地渲染出来。

 hr {
  display: none;
} 

如上面的CSS代码所示,如果将<hr>display属性设置为none,则该元素将不会被显示出来。如果我们在页面中引用了这段代码,所有的<hr>都将消失不见。

如果您遇到了这种情况,可以尝试在代码中删除这个属性或更改它为其他值,例如:

 hr {
  display: block;
  border: none;
  height: 1px;
  background-color: #ddd;
} 

以上是一个基本的<hr>样式,它将会显示一条细线,并将其颜色设置为浅灰色。您可以根据需要对其进行自定义。

在某些情况下,元素也可能被其他CSS属性覆盖,例如visibilityopacity。在这种情况下,检查页面中其他的CSS代码以查找并修复这些问题。

总之,如果您在使用CSS中的<hr>时遇到了问题,请先检查您的CSS代码,确保没有覆盖或隐藏了该元素。

评论
91云脑
Lv.1普通用户

62845

帖子

12

小组

80

积分

站长交流